-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
 - 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
 - 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
 - 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
 - 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
 - 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
 - 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
 
                        查看更多
                        
                    
                摘要
 
在现代化的大型停车场中,智能停车管理系统使得车辆进出手续简单,安全性高,实现了对车辆的自动检测、计费、统计、显示等功能,大大节省了人力资源,提高了工作效率。整个停车管理系统中,车辆检测部分是系统的关键。
本文介绍了一种以AT89S52型单片机为主控芯片的停车场车辆检测系统。系统利用红外线对进出停车场的车辆进行检测,控制闸杆机的自动起落,并具备车位显示以及报警提示功能。该系统配合IC卡和图像监测处理装置可以构成一套完整的智能停车系统,从而实现大型停车场的智能化管理。文中重点介绍了车辆检测部分的设计原理,并给出了相应的硬件接口电路及软件编程要点。 
 
关键字:红外线;AT89S52;串口通信
                         
目录
摘要	1
目录	2
一  系统总体介绍	3
二  器件简介	4
1.主控制器AT89S52	4
(1) MSC-51芯片资源简介	4
(2)单片机的引脚	5
(3)89S51单机的电源线	6
(4)89S51单片机的外接晶体引脚	6
(5)89S51单片机的控制线	6
(6)89S51单片机复位方式	7
2.红外对管	8
(1)红外对管简介	8
(2)红外对管基本参数	9
(3)多路控制的红外遥控系统	9
3.运算放大器LM358	10
(1)LM358简介	10
(2)特性	10
(3)参数	11
(4)LM358内部电路图	11
4.数码管显示器简介	11
(1)数码管的分类	11
(2)怎样测量数码管引脚	12
(3)数码管使用的电流与电压	12
(4)数码管参数	12
三  系统设计	14
1.硬件设计	14
(1)单片机最小系统	14
(2)电源电路	14
(3)报警驱动电路	14
(4)串口通信模块电路	15
(5)红外检测模块	15
2.软件设计	16
(1)软件流程图	16
(2)程序清单	16
四  实验过程中经验及心得	22
五  致  谢	23
六  参考文献	24
附件1:系统整体电路图	25
 
一  系统总体介绍
整个停车管理系统示意图如图1所示,信息显示牌为LED显示屏,显示当前时间及车位信息当有车进入时,司机进行刷卡,刷卡信号由控制器读入,控制闸杆机抬起,语音提示“欢迎光临 ”,当地感线圈检测到车辆进入时,更新车位信息,抓拍车辆图片,闸杆机下落;同样,当车辆驶出,司机刷卡,控制闸杆机抬起,语音提示“谢谢光临,当地感线圈检测到车辆离开,抓拍车辆信息,闸杆机下落并更新车位信息而车辆的图像信息、IC卡数据信息的处理都将由值班室的上位机完成。
 
图1停车管理系统示意
 
控制器设计框图如图2所示,系统选用AT89S52型单片机作为主控芯片,单片机通过读红外信号和锁相环电路的电平变化检测车辆的到来。DS1302时钟电路为系统提供精确的时间信息,通过驱动LED显示牌实时显示车位及时间信息,系统具备与上位机的串行通信通信接口。
  
图2智能停车场车辆检测系统总体设计框
二  器件简介
1.主控制器AT89S52
(1) MSC-51芯片资源简介
  89S51是MCS-51系列单片机的典型产品,我们就这一代表性的机型进行系统的讲解。89S51单片机包含中央处理器、程序存储器(ROM)、数据存储器(RAM)、定时/计数器、并行接口、串行接口和中断系统等几大单元及数据总线、地址总线和控制总线等三大总线,现在我们分别加以说明:
 
图3.1    单片机内部结构示意图
A.中央处理器
中央处理器(CPU)是整个单片机的核心部件,是8位数据宽度的处理器,能处理8位二进制数据或代码,CPU负责控制、指挥和调度整个单元系统协调的工作,完成运算和控制输入输出功能等操作。
B.数据存储器(RAM)
89S51内部有128个8位用户数据存储单元和128个专用寄存器单元,它们是统一编址的,专用寄存器只能用于存放控制指令数据,用户只能访问,而不能用于存放用户数据,所以,用户能使用的RAM只有128个,可存放读写的数据,运算的中间结果或用户定义的字型表。
C.程序存储器(ROM)
89S51共有4KB掩膜ROM,最大可扩展64K字节,用于存放用户程序,原始数据或表格。
D.定时/计数器:
89S51有两个16位的可编程定时/计数器,以实现定时或计数产生中断用于控制程序转向。
E.并行输入输出(I/O)口:
89S51共有4组8位I/O口(P0、 P1、P2或P3),用于对外部数据的传输。
          
 (2)单片机的引脚
89S51单片机内部总线是单总线结构,即数据总线和地址总线是公用的. 89S51有40条引脚, 与其他51系列单片机引脚是兼容的. 这40条引脚可分为I/O接口线、电源线、控制线、外接晶体线4部分. 89S51单片机为双列直插式封装结构, 如图3.
                您可能关注的文档
- 《毕业设计(论文)-VB高速公路票据管理系统实现与设计》.doc
 - 《毕业设计(论文)-VC图书信息管理系统》.doc
 - 《毕业设计(论文)-VB酒店管理系统设计》.doc
 - 《毕业设计(论文)-VC与MATLAB混合编程》.doc
 - 《毕业设计(论文)-VC学生信息管理系统》.doc
 - 《毕业设计(论文)-VB餐饮娱乐管理信息系统设计与实现》.doc
 - 《毕业设计(论文)-VC高校运动会管理系统的设计和实现》.doc
 - 《毕业设计(论文)-VC编程软件来开发上位机与下位机之间通信编程》.doc
 - 《毕业设计(论文)-VFP产品销售管理信息系统》.doc
 - 《毕业设计(论文)-VFP工资管理系业设计》.doc
 
- 《毕业设计(论文)-基于51单片机的酒精测试仪设计》.doc
 - 《毕业设计(论文)-基于51单片机超声波测距仪的设计》.doc
 - 《毕业设计(论文)-基于52单片机的低频信号发生器设计》.doc
 - 《毕业设计(论文)-基于555定时器的闪光灯设计》.doc
 - 《毕业设计(论文)-基于51单片机的频率合成设计毕业论文》.doc
 - 《毕业设计(论文)-基于8051单片机的交通信号控制系统设计》.doc
 - 《毕业设计(论文)-基于8031单片机温度控制系统设计》.doc
 - 《毕业设计(论文)-基于8031单片机温度控制系统设计1》.doc
 - 《毕业设计(论文)-基于8051单片机的家庭安全用电控制系统设计》.doc
 - 《毕业设计(论文)-基于8051和ADC0809CCN的数据采集设计》.doc
 
原创力文档
                        

文档评论(0)